Madison Academy falls to Tanner

BY SCOTT WRIGHT/FOR THE RECORD

Madison Academy fought hard, but the team fell to Tanner 7-13 Thursday night.

The Tanner defense was just a bit better in the end, holding the Mustang offense to only one play of more than 10 yards and only seven points. The Mustang offense never seemed to find a rhythm and struggled all night to make even three to four yards.

A first half with only 34 total yards followed by a second half that fell short of fifty yards, with the exception of Kerryon Johnson’s 83-yard touchdown.

Fred Rich and Hayden Stephens led the Rattlers Thursday night with Stephens scoring on a long touchdown run in the third quarter and Rich claiming the only turnover of the night by intercepting Mustang quarterback Justin Wimberly.

The Mustangs found brief electricity in the legs of Johnson on an eye-opening 83-yard touchdown run in the fourth quarter, but it was not be enough to defeat the 2A powerhouse, Tanner Rattlers.

The Mustangs will host Lauderdale County next Friday night for its first region game, while the Tanner Rattlers will square off against the Red Bay Tigers.

The Madison Academy Mustangs entered the 2012 season on the highest note possible short of winning a state championship.

The Mustangs against tough competition in the previous season and came within a matter of inches from winning the coveted blue map in Tuscaloosa last December. The Rattlers, could say the same thing, with the only exception being the classification.

Last year Madison Academy had finished as the state runner-up in class 3A while the Tanner Rattlers had come up short in the class 2A final against Elba.
